Output eda64929366a2719fed064a164f1d1579cd914ae913442de0a763f88b0d01d27:3

value
199883386
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d0fc57c90dc13ae9fa8bb24d5ec3f7a2f9c5cd16bce35b898fdb4593128919b6
address
tb1p6r790jgdcyawn75tkfx4aslh5tuutngkhn34hzv0mdzexy5frxmqjy8tkl
transaction
eda64929366a2719fed064a164f1d1579cd914ae913442de0a763f88b0d01d27
confirmations
61128
spent
true